#E69689 Color
#E69689 is rgb(230, 150, 137) in RGB, hsl(8, 65%, 72%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 35%, 40%, 10%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Salmon Rose (#E7968B),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.03.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#E69689 Channel Values
How #E69689 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 230 · G 150 · B 137 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 8° · S 65% · L 72%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 8° · S 40% · V 90%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 35% · Y 40% · K 10%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.31:1 vs white · 9.09: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#E69689 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#E69689 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#E69689?
#E69689 is a light red — rgb(230, 150, 137) in RGB and hsl(8, 65%, 72%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Salmon Rose (#E7968B),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.03.
What is the RGB value of #E69689?
#E69689 is rgb(230, 150, 137) — red 230, green 150, and blue 137 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#E69689?
#E69689 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 35%, 40%, 10%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#E69689 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#E69689 scores 2.31:1 against white and 9.09: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#E69689 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#E69689 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darksalmon (#E9967A) at a CIE76 distance of 8.43,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
